using CuteUtils.Misc;
namespace CuteUtils.Tests.Misc;
[TestClass]
public class StringExtTests_Coverage
{
[TestMethod]
public void ToFileName_EmptyAndNull_ReturnsEmptyOrThrows()
{
Assert.AreEqual("", "".ToFileName());
Assert.AreEqual("", "".ToFileName(allowSpaces: false));
string? nullStr = null;
_ = Assert.ThrowsExactly<NullReferenceException>(() => nullStr!.ToFileName());
}
[TestMethod]
public void ToFileName_NormalizesUnicodeAccents()
{
string input = "Ångström Îñţérñåţîöñåļ";
string output = input.ToFileName();
Assert.IsFalse(output.Any(c => c > 127)); // no extended unicode
Assert.Contains("An", output); // Å -> A + n (typical decompose)
}
[TestMethod]
public void ToFileName_LongString_TrimsProperly()
{
string longInput = new('x', 500);
string result = longInput.ToFileName();
Assert.IsLessThanOrEqualTo(255, result.Length, "File name should be trimmed to FS-safe length");
}
[TestMethod]
public void ToPath_EmptyAndNull_ReturnsEmptyOrThrows()
{
Assert.AreEqual("", "".ToPath());
string? nullStr = null;
_ = Assert.ThrowsExactly<NullReferenceException>(() => nullStr!.ToPath());
}
[TestMethod]
public void ToPath_RemovesBothFileAndPathInvalidChars()
{
string input = "t<>e\"s|t/dir\\name:*?";
string output = input.ToPath();
foreach (char c in Path.GetInvalidPathChars())
{
Assert.DoesNotContain(c, output);
}
}
[TestMethod]
public void Truncate_HandlesNull_Throws()
{
string? nullStr = null;
_ = Assert.ThrowsExactly<NullReferenceException>(() => nullStr!.Truncate(5));
}
[TestMethod]
public void Truncate_LongString_Performance()
{
string longStr = new('x', 10_000);
string result = longStr.Truncate(100);
Assert.AreEqual(100, result.Length);
}
[TestMethod]
public void CorrectNewLine_EmptyString_ReturnsEmpty()
{
Assert.AreEqual("", "".CorrectNewLine());
}
[TestMethod]
public void CorrectNewLine_Mixed_Newlines_Normalizes()
{
string mixed = "a\r\nb\nc\rd";
string result = mixed.CorrectNewLine();
if (Environment.OSVersion.Platform == PlatformID.Unix)
{
Assert.AreEqual("a\nb\nc\nd", result);
}
else
{
Assert.AreEqual("a\r\nb\r\nc\r\nd", result);
}
}
[TestMethod]
public void RemoveWhitespaces_UnicodeSpaces()
{
string input = "a\u2003b\u3000c"; // em-space, ideographic space
Assert.AreEqual("abc", input.RemoveWhitespaces());
}
[TestMethod]
public void Reverse_EmptyAndSingleCharacter()
{
Assert.AreEqual("", "".Reverse());
Assert.AreEqual("a", "a".Reverse());
}
[TestMethod]
public void Reverse_UnicodeCombiningCharacters()
{
string input = "e\u0301"; // é composed as e + diacritic
string result = input.Reverse();
Assert.AreEqual("\u0301e", result);
}
[TestMethod]
public void ReplaceCaseInsensitive_UnicodeCase()
{
string input = "Straße"; // Eszett
string replaced = input.ReplaceCaseInsensitive("ß", "ss");
Assert.AreEqual("Strasse", replaced);
}
[TestMethod]
public void ReplaceCaseInsensitive_ReplacesOverlappingCorrectly()
{
string input = "aaaa";
string replaced = input.ReplaceCaseInsensitive("aa", "b");
Assert.AreEqual("bb", replaced); // correct non-overlapping behavior
}
[TestMethod]
public void RemoveDiacritics_RemovesAccents_PreservesBaseCharacters()
{
// composed character
string caf = "café";
Assert.AreEqual("cafe", caf.RemoveDiacritics());
// another composed example (Å -> A or Ang depending on normalization)
string ang = "Ångström";
Assert.AreEqual("Angstrom", ang.RemoveDiacritics());
// decomposed form: e + combining acute accent
string decomposed = "e\u0301"; // e + ◌́
Assert.AreEqual("e", decomposed.RemoveDiacritics());
// empty string stays empty
Assert.AreEqual(string.Empty, string.Empty.RemoveDiacritics());
// null behavior: current implementation will throw NullReferenceException
string? nullStr = null;
_ = Assert.ThrowsExactly<NullReferenceException>(() => nullStr!.RemoveDiacritics());
}
}
